FIGURE 4 in Two new records in Orchidaceae (Vanillinae) from southernmost Colombian Amazonia: Vanilla javieri, a new species, and Vanilla appendiculata
FIGURE 4. Stereomicroscope photographs of Vanilla javieri Barona-Colmenares (A, B, C, D) and Vanilla appendiculata (E, F, G, H). A. Labellum claw. The inner surface of the labellum claw of V. javieri is lanuginose (A) versus warty in V. appendiculata (E). B. Penicillate callus. The callus of V. javieri (B) is less congested than the callus of V. appendiculata (F), with thicker and less numerous laciniae forming a tuft. Additionally, the veins in V. javieri are sinuous and contrast against the parallel veins in V. appendiculata. C. Vanilla javieri lacks appendages between the penicillate callus and the lip apex (C) versus few warty appendages connecting both in V. appendiculata (G). D. Ornamentation of the lip apex. Vanilla javieri exhibits few, small, digitiform papillae (D) versus longer and more numerous foliaceous appendages in V. appendiculata (H). Photographs: A.A. Barona-Colmenares & N. Oviedo (V. javieri) and A.A. Barona-Colmenares & J. Potosí (V. appendiculata).

FIGURE 5 in Vanilla cameroniana (Orchidaceae, Vanilloideae), a new species from French Guiana and new records from the Guiana Shield
FIGURE 5. New Vanilla records from the Guiana Shield based on herbarium material. A–F Vanilla sprucei, A–B. perianth dissection, C–D. labellum apex, E–F. column apex and anther. G–H. Vanilla dressleri, I. Vanilla corinnae. Based on Redden 2518, US (A,C,E); Redden 1843, US (B,D,F); Cremers 13016, NY (G); Wurdack 43074, US (H); and Wurdack 43170, US (I). Photographs by A. Damián.
FIGURE 4 in Vanilla cameroniana (Orchidaceae, Vanilloideae), a new species from French Guiana and new records from the Guiana Shield
FIGURE 4. Geographic distribution of the species discussed in this study, including the limits of the Guiana Shield. The black-colored datapoints on the map represent occurrences documented in the GBIF database, while the blue-colored datapoints indicate new records reported in this study. Additionally, red datapoints represent the newly described species. The asterisk (*) is used to indicate type material.
